Output e35a6cce0769e0af5dca1abfa3dd472229d3308e38f4edd61e676ae90d2a66b1:3

value
1000867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351cfc601431af0c6ae74fc2d9466d5547224a0d OP_EQUAL
address
36XrTgXYPkXNWrtSu2BBWLZPa8WgqTvVNq
transaction
e35a6cce0769e0af5dca1abfa3dd472229d3308e38f4edd61e676ae90d2a66b1
confirmations
330415
spent
true